您好,登錄后才能下訂單哦!
在Ubuntu中,root權(quán)限下的系統(tǒng)更新管理策略主要包括以下幾個方面:
sudo apt update
sudo apt upgrade
sudo apt dist-upgrade
這些命令分別用于更新已安裝的軟件包列表、升級所有可升級的軟件包以及升級系統(tǒng)到最新版本。
sudo apt install unattended-upgrade
然后,編輯/etc/apt/apt.conf.d/50unattended-upgrades
文件,根據(jù)需要配置自動更新策略。例如,以下配置表示每天檢查一次更新,并且只允許安全更新自動安裝:
Unattended-Upgrade::Package-Blacklist {
// 禁用非安全更新的自動安裝
"vim";
"emacs";
};
Unattended-Upgrade::Install-On-Boot {
// 在系統(tǒng)啟動時自動安裝更新
true;
};
Unattended-Upgrade::Min-Age {
// 設(shè)置檢查更新的最小時間間隔(單位為天)
1;
};
Unattended-Upgrade::Date {
// 設(shè)置檢查更新的最早日期(格式為YYYY-MM-DD)
"2022-01-01";
};
crontab -e
然后,添加以下行以每天檢查并安裝更新:
0 0 * * * apt update && apt upgrade -y
保存并退出編輯器。Cron將根據(jù)指定的時間間隔自動執(zhí)行系統(tǒng)更新。
總之,在Ubuntu root權(quán)限下,可以使用APT包管理器、Unattended-Upgrade軟件包和定時任務(wù)(Cron)等多種策略來管理系統(tǒng)更新。根據(jù)實際需求和安全考慮,可以選擇合適的策略進(jìn)行系統(tǒng)更新。
免責(zé)聲明:本站發(fā)布的內(nèi)容(圖片、視頻和文字)以原創(chuàng)、轉(zhuǎn)載和分享為主,文章觀點不代表本網(wǎng)站立場,如果涉及侵權(quán)請聯(lián)系站長郵箱:is@yisu.com進(jìn)行舉報,并提供相關(guān)證據(jù),一經(jīng)查實,將立刻刪除涉嫌侵權(quán)內(nèi)容。